Package org.sonarsource.analyzer.commons
@ParametersAreNonnullByDefault
package org.sonarsource.analyzer.commons
-
ClassDescriptionUse to create
BuiltInQualityProfilesDefinition.NewBuiltInQualityProfile
based on json file, for profiles implementingBuiltInQualityProfilesDefinition
Not designed for multi-threadsCreates external rule repository based on json file in the format[ { "key": "...", "name": "..." }, ...
A utility class to de/serialize a List<byte[]> and Map<String, byte[]> from/to byte[].Not designed for multi-threadsA utility class to compute the offsets which should be provided to SonarQube APIs (highlighting, CPD).